These Cheesy Zucchini Muffins with Ham Toppings are a savory twist on traditional muffins, making them perfect for breakfast, brunch, or as a snack. Packed with grated zucchini, two kinds of cheese, and topped with crispy ham, these muffins are moist, flavorful, and utterly irresistible. They’re a great way to sneak veggies into your day while enjoying a cheesy, comforting treat!
Why You’ll Love This Recipe:
- Savory & Cheesy: A delicious combination of cheddar and Parmesan cheeses in every bite.
- Moist & Flavorful: Grated zucchini keeps the muffins tender and moist.
- Versatile: Perfect for breakfast, brunch, lunchboxes, or snacks.
📝 Ingredients (Makes 12 Muffins):
For the Muffins:
- 2 medium zucchinis , grated (about 2 cups / 300g ) 🥒
- 1 cup (125g) all-purpose flour 🌾
- 1 cup (100g) grated cheddar cheese 🧀
- ½ cup (50g) grated Parmesan cheese 🧀
- ½ tsp baking powder
- ¼ tsp baking soda
- ½ tsp salt
- ¼ tsp black pepper
- 2 large eggs 🥚
- ¼ cup (60ml) olive oil or melted butter 🫒
- ¼ cup (60ml) milk 🥛
For the Ham Toppings:
- 4 slices of deli ham , cut into small pieces or strips 🍖
- Extra shredded cheddar cheese (optional, for topping )
👩🍳 Instructions:
Step 1: Prepare the Zucchini 🥒
- Grate the zucchinis using a box grater. Place the grated zucchini in a clean kitchen towel or paper towels and squeeze out excess moisture. This step is crucial to prevent soggy muffins.
Step 2: Mix Dry Ingredients 🥄
- In a large mixing bowl, whisk together the all-purpose flour , baking powder , baking soda , salt , and black pepper .
Step 3: Combine Wet Ingredients 🥚
- In a separate bowl, whisk together the eggs , olive oil or melted butter , and milk until smooth.
Step 4: Combine Wet and Dry Ingredients 🥣
- Add the wet ingredients to the dry ingredients and stir until just combined. Avoid overmixing to keep the muffins tender.
- Fold in the grated zucchini , cheddar cheese , and Parmesan cheese until evenly distributed.
Step 5: Fill the Muffin Tin 🥮
- Preheat your oven to 375°F (190°C) . Line a 12-cup muffin tin with paper liners or grease it lightly.
- Divide the batter evenly among the muffin cups, filling each about ¾ full .
- Top each muffin with a piece of deli ham and optionally sprinkle extra shredded cheddar cheese on top for an extra cheesy finish.
Step 6: Bake 🔥
- Bake in the preheated oven for 20–25 minutes , or until the muffins are golden brown and a toothpick inserted into the center comes out clean.
Step 7: Cool and Serve 🍴
- Let the muffins cool in the pan for 5 minutes, then transfer them to a wire rack to cool completely.
- Serve warm or at room temperature. Pair with a side salad, soup, or enjoy them on their own!
Tips for Success:
- Add-Ins: Stir in diced bell peppers, sautéed onions, or cooked bacon bits for extra flavor.
- Make Ahead: These muffins can be made ahead of time and stored in an airtight container in the refrigerator for up to 3 days . Reheat in the microwave for 15–20 seconds before serving.
- Freeze Option: Freeze cooled muffins in a freezer-safe bag for up to 3 months . Thaw overnight in the refrigerator or reheat directly from frozen.
- Gluten-Free Option: Substitute the all-purpose flour with a gluten-free flour blend for a gluten-free version.
Nutritional Information (per muffin, makes 12):
- Calories: ~180
- Protein: ~8g
- Carbohydrates: ~12g
- Fat: ~11g
Enjoy these Cheesy Zucchini Muffins with Ham Toppings as a savory, cheesy treat that’s packed with flavor and nutrients. The combination of tender zucchini, gooey cheese, and crispy ham makes these muffins a crowd-pleaser whether served for breakfast, brunch, or as a snack. They’re easy to make, customizable, and perfect for any occasion. Bite into one and savor the deliciousness!